Abstract

One of the regencies in the province of Riau is Kampar. Pasar Kuok is one of the well-known markets in Kampar Regency, a Regency that continues to employ traditional markets as shopping destinations for the neighborhood. Traffic congestion is a common occurrence in Pasar Kuok, especially on market days like Tuesdays. Therefore, a research on parking management is required to ensure that the demand for parking spots can be met. In order to solve issues that exist in the Pasar Kuok area, this study intends to determine the availability of existing parking lots, identify the effects of parking activities, and and obtain scenarios as an alternative to solving problems. Data from the (a) Parking Patrol, (b) parking volume, and (c) parking inventory must all be collected. Based on the survey, there are two types of parking available at Pasar Kuok: on-street parking (using the road) and off-street parking (not using the road). After analyzing the data regarding the existing parking conditions as well as the problem solving recommendations, the results obtained from the analysis that have been carried out, given three scenarios for parking repairs, in order to be an alternative to solve existing problems. The first alternative is to change the width of the parking space unit capacity (SRP) for motorcycles. The second alternative is to change the location of the parking lot on the car street into a motorbike parking lot. The third alternative is to move the motorbike parking lot on Jalan Pulau Balai to the on-street motorcycle parking area located on Jalan Lintas Pekanbaru – West Sumatra A.

Abstract

Peat water contains low pH and acid caused corrosive on cementation structure as stabilized soil based alkali activated POFA. The soil samples mixed with different percentages of POFA (5%, 10%, and 15%) and alkali activator solution (sodium silica; Na2SiO3) and sodium hydroxide, NaOH) were immersed in peat water for various durations (0, 7, 14, and 28 days). The test results for the physical properties of the soil showed that the addition of POFA decreased the plasticity index and increased the optimum moisture content (OMC) while reducing the dry density (MDD) of the soil mixture. Furthermore, the unconfined compressive strength test indicated that the soil's strength increased at a 5% and 10% POFA content after 7 days of immersion, with strengths of 760 kPa and 1312 kPa, respectively. However, the strength significantly decreased by over 50% after 28 days of immersion, reached 365 kPa and 372 kPa for the respective POFA contents. A slight increase in soil strength was observed with the addition of 15% POFA content during the immersion period. Although the strength obtained after 28 days was almost the same for all mixtures at 356 kPa, higher levels of aluminosilicate synthesis as 15% POFA can enhance the bonding strength between soil particles, making the test specimen more resistant to acid attack.

Abstract

Modern soil stabilization has included environmentally friendly materials in the mixture design. Adding an alkali activator provides an alternative to the innovation of the binder agent for soil stabilization. This study aims to know the effect of adding the alkali activator soluble for soil-POFA mixture on changes in the soil strength characteristic through an unconfined compression test (UCT). The alkali activators are sodium silica (Na2SiO3) and Sodium Hydroxide (NaOH). They prepare with a ratio Si/Al: 1.0, 1.5, 2.0, 2.5, and NaOH concentrated at 10M. Compressive strength to the soil-POFA mixture obtained slightly increased strength, and the soil is clayey sand poorly graded. However, adding the alkali activator increases the soil strength significantly. Thus, the soil-POFA with the alkali activators gained the maximum compressive strength on a ratio of 2.5, and it all has the characteristic of rapid hardening in the initial period as a binder agent.

Abstract

Program Pengabdian Kepada Masyarakat ini dilaksanakan dengan tujuan utama untuk menilai pemahaman siswa SMK N 2 Pekanbaru mengenai Keselamatan dan Kesehatan Kerja (K3) di sektor konstruksi. Urgensi dari kegiatan ini didasari oleh tingginya angka kecelakaan kerja di sektor konstruksi, serta minimnya pemahaman dan keterampilan dasar siswa SMK sebagai calon tenaga kerja terhadap prinsip-prinsip K3, khususnya dalam penggunaan Alat Pelindung Diri (APD) dan Alat Pemadam Api Ringan (APAR). Penilaian program dilakukan melalui metode pre-test dan post-test, yang bertujuan untuk mengukur tingkat pengetahuan siswa sebelum dan sesudah mengikuti sesi edukasi singkat. Hasil dari evaluasi menunjukkan peningkatan yang signifikan dalam pemahaman siswa, di mana rata-rata skor pre-test yang awalnya 20,8% meningkat menjadi 74,6% pada post-test setelah pelaksanaan edukasi. Instrumen evaluasi yang digunakan dalam program ini telah divalidasi melalui uji korelasi dengan nilai korelasi sebesar 0,78, yang menunjukkan bahwa instrumen tersebut memiliki reliabilitas yang baik dan dapat diandalkan untuk mengukur pengetahuan siswa. Selain itu, evaluasi terhadap kepuasan peserta juga dilakukan, dengan hasil yang menunjukkan bahwa 85% peserta merasa sangat puas dengan keseluruhan program, terutama terkait dengan fasilitas yang disediakan dan kemampuan narasumber dalam menyampaikan materi. Diharapkan program serupa dapat dilaksanakan secara berkelanjutan.
